Trump return to White House will test ‘rocky’ relationship with Trudeau

U.S. President-elect Donald Trump is someone who ‘carries a grudge,’ but Prime Minister Justin Trudeau must find a way to ‘make the relationship work,’ say observers.
United States president-elect Donald Trump will return to the White House in January 2025, after winning the Nov. 5 presidential election.

After years of testy dynamics between Justin Trudeau and Donald Trump, the Republican’s return to the White House will force the prime minister to overcome discord with the unpredictable president-elect.
